Tailstrike Designs Releases Milan Bergamo Airport for MSFS

Scenery developer Tailstrike Designs has recently announced on their Facebook page, the release of their scenery rendition of Bergamo Airport (LIME) located in Milan. For the not so new Microsoft Flight Simulator.

The scenery boasts a range of features such as a fully updated 2021 airport layout, interior terminal modelling, AFIS system, full surrounding details, animated jetways, and much more (Full feature list at the end of the article)

Tailstrike Designs disclosed in a previous post that they plan to convert the scenery to X-Plane 11 and P3D in the future. Tailstrike Designs also plans to release Prague Airport (LKPR) for MSFS in the coming weeks.

Bergamo Airport (LIME) is one of three airports in the Milan region and is the third busiest airport in Italy seeing traffic from airlines such as Ryanair, EasyJet, Alitalia, Wizz Air, DHL, and many more. The airport saw almost four million passenger movements last year, a drastic reduction from the previous years ten to thirteen million movements due to the COVID-19 pandemic.

Feature List

  • Updated Main Terminal and Apron with the last 2021 Layout
  • Interior Terminal Modelling with Passengers
  • AFIS System
  • New North Apron
  • Full surrounding details (No Blurry Satellitare Image)
  • Animated Jetways
  • Custom Signs
  • Full Native PBR Models
  • FPS Friendly
